From the Dust Jacket: "The first general survey of the vanishing seating culture of sub-Saharan Africa. Drawing on over 170 examples this book offers a survey of the seats of sub-Saharan Africa an integral part of a traditional culture that is already disappearing. The various essays by noted ethnologists address the cultural histories and aesthetics of African seats and other objects as well as their regional characteristics. In addition there is a wealth of photographic evidence documenting the use of seats and their original contexts both past and present.". First Edition in English. Oversize Hardcover. Offering "unheard of bargains in home furnishings" this catalogue includes rocking chairs dining chairs beds dressers desks tables bookcases buffets kitchen cupboards china cabinets wardrobes and other furniture -- much of it Mission style and made of quarter-sawn oak. Also includes refrigerators and stoves luggage sewing machines. A good visual reference for period styles available to shoppers on a budget. W/ & H. Walker unknown

First edition of this very scarce and beautifully illustrated catalogue filled with Colonial & Federal Revival furniture in maple including bedroom living room kitchen dining room and smoking room furniture. Of particular interest are the nicely printed varnish/stain samples including Natural or Honeytone on Birdseye Maple; Green Moire on Birdseye Maple Antique Maple Finish and Brown produced with acid staining. Wang Shixiang's forty-year research into Ming and early Qing furniture covering stools and chairs tables beds shelves and cabinets with color plates and technical drawings of huanghuali zitan and other hardwoods.
